GL's CDMA Protocol Analyzer can be used to analyze and view protocols across A1 (between Base Station Controller and Mobile Switching Center), A3 andĪ7 (between two Base Station Controllers), A9 (between Base Station Controller and Packet Control Function), and A11 (between Packet Control Function and The PDSN canĪct as either a standalone Network Access Server (NAS), Home Agent (HA) or a Foreign Agent (FA). The PDSN is the Gateway from the RAN into the public and private networks. The PCF routes IP data packets between the MS and the PDSN. Messages to the PDSN using Ethernet protocols. It connects toĮach Mobile Telephone Exchange (MTX) using channelized T1 lines for voice and circuit switched data and to un-channelized T1 lines for signaling and control In addition, the BSC is also responsible for mobility management. The BSC routes PSD and CSD messages between the cell sites and the MSC. The BTS connects to the BSC through un-channelized T1s and A-bis protocols (proprietary to a particular vendor) based on RAN maps the Mobile Station ID to a unique link layer identifier that is used to communicate with the PDSN, validate the MS for access service, and maintain theĮstablished transmission links. The RAN consists of the Air Link, Base Station Transceiver Subsystem (BTS), Base Station Controller (BSC), and a part of Packet Control Function (PCF). A Mobile Station accesses the CDMA2000 network through the The CDMA2000 network comprises of the Radio Access Network (RAN) and the Core Network.
